Houston — Gastech, the leading global conference and exhibition of the international gas, LNG and energy industries, launched its 2019 conference program and return to Houston with a reception at The Houston Club on May 8.

“We are delighted to bring Gastech back to Houston – the energy capital of the world,” said dmg events President Christopher Hudson. “Gastech provides a platform for discussion and debate about how we use gas as the future energy source, and we are proud to provide a program that showcases the latest technology, innovations and global solutions,” said Hudson.

The 2019 conference program includes an exclusive forum to identify growth solutions in markets that have recently pivoted to natural gas. The Asia LNG Market Development Forum includes key players from Asia, the world’s largest purchaser of LNG, to discuss the most prominent developments and opportunities facing the LNG market.

A record 1,100 abstracts were submitted this year, with 180 papers selected, and a total of over 400 energy professionals slated to present or speak at Gastech 2019. The Gastech Governing Body, which is comprised of four key co-chairs and industry leaders, formulated the strategies and technical programming, as well as vetted and selected the abstracts to be presented.

Three of the four co-chairs provided remarks at the launch event, including: Andrew Clifton, General Manager and Chief Executive Officer, Society of International Gas Tanker and Terminal Operators; Paul Sullivan, Senior Vice President, Global LNG & FLNG, WorleyParsons; and Christopher Caswell, Director, Global LNG and FLNG Technology & Development, KBR. Sullivan focuses on the strategic portion of the program, and Clifton and Caswell focus on the technical program.

Representatives from Gastech 2019 co-host companies participating in the launch event included Renee Pirrong, Manager, Research and Analysis, Tellurian; Glenn Wright, President, Shell Energy North America; and Sarah Howell, Marketing Communications, LNG, ExxonMobil.

“In the United States, we have a front row seat to the confluence of two of the biggest macro trends happening today in the global gas market,” said Pirrong. “There is a massive supply push from the U.S. where we have a bounty of natural gas. At the same time, there is a demand pull from the rest of the world. The world needs a prolific amount of natural gas.”

“Trading and supply is like the central nervous system of Shell; it connects every part of our business,” said Wright. “This year, the topics at Gastech address growth opportunities and challenges in our energy portfolios and gas is a critical component.”

In addition to addressing market trends and opportunities, Gastech 2019 will feature diversity and inclusion programming. Specifically, ExxonMobil will announce the recipients of its Power Play Awards, which recognize the accomplishments of remarkable women and the men who uphold the importance of supporting and empowering in the workplace at the event.

“What began as a popular series of diversity-focused ExxonMobil Power Play networking events has evolved into an award that demonstrates how a mutually supportive environment can help support business outcomes across all parts of the LNG value chain,” said Howell.

Gastech 2019 is taking place at NRG Center in Houston September 17-19. For more information and to register visit the website at www.gastechevent.com.

About Gastech

Gastech 2019 continues the program’s track record as the most comprehensive global gas and LNG event, bringing together upstream, midstream and downstream professionals to convene and conduct business.

The event spans nearly 590,000 square feet of exhibition space, showcasing over 700 international, regional and local exhibitors while gathering over 35,000 international professionals from across the global gas, LNG and energy industries. More than 3,500 delegates and 1,200 ministers, government officials, presidents, managing directors, CEOs and chairmen will hear from 400 senior speakers from across all industry sectors. Gastech’s website is www.gastechevent.com.

Gastech is a flagship event among dmg events’ 80 event portfolio. dmg events is an international exhibitions and publishing company serving professional communities in diverse industries including construction, energy, coatings, transport, hospitality and design.
